Weathering the Storms in the Illinois Valley

Living in the Illinois Valley offers incredible natural beauty, but it also presents a rigorous test for any residential structure. The local climate is distinct, featuring a mix of Mediterranean heat in the summer and significant, sustained rainfall throughout the autumn and winter months. This cycle of expansion during the hot, dry spells and contraction during the wet, freezing months puts immense stress on roofing materials.

When a roof is not maintained or was installed without considering these local extremes, failure is inevitable. The persistent moisture common in our region often leads to the growth of moss and algae, which can lift shingles and allow water to seep underneath. Once moisture penetrates the decking, the structural integrity of your home is at risk. You might notice dark spots on your ceilings, curling shingles, or granules collecting in your gutters. These are not just cosmetic issues; they are warning signs that the barrier between your living space and the elements is breaking down.

Homeowners in this area need to be proactive rather than reactive. Waiting for a major leak often results in expensive emergency repairs that could have been avoided with timely intervention. Maintenance and Moss Control

In our wet environment, moss is a roof’s silent enemy. It acts like a sponge, holding moisture against the granules and accelerating degradation. Regular maintenance extends the lifespan of your investment significantly.

  • Moss Removal: Gentle but effective removal techniques that clear the growth without stripping the protective granules from the shingles.
  • Gutter Cleaning: Ensuring that drainage systems are free of debris so that water flows away from the fascia and foundation, preventing back-ups and ice dams.
  • Annual Inspections: A routine check-up to catch minor issues, such as loose flashing or popped nails, before they become expensive problems.

Navigating Local Requirements and Conditions

Operating in the Illinois Valley means understanding more than just shingles and nails; it requires knowledge of the local landscape and regulations. The area surrounding Cave Junction, including nearby communities like Selma, Kerby, and O’Brien, has specific zoning and building codes designed to ensure safety.

The Construction Contractors Board (CCB) in Oregon sets high standards for licensing, and ensuring your project complies with these regulations is part of the service. This includes pulling the necessary permits for re-roofing projects or structural repairs. Compliance is not just about following the law; it is about ensuring that your home insurance will honor claims in the future. Unpermitted work can lead to significant headaches when selling a home or filing a claim for storm damage.

Furthermore, the local geography plays a role in material selection. Homes closer to the tree line may require gutter guards to handle pine needles, while properties in more exposed areas might need shingles with higher wind ratings. Energy efficiency is also a growing concern for many residents. Properly vented roofs and cool-roofing materials can significantly lower cooling costs during those hot summer spikes, taking the strain off your HVAC system.
